Résumé
Nurse practitioners (NPs) take on diverse and essential roles. In an exclusive interview, Representative Tarik Khan, PhD, FNP-BC, highlights the impact NPs can have in the political arena. Transitioning from an NP to a legislator in Pennsylvania, Dr. Khan's journey reflects his commitment to health care reform, driven by hospital closures, lack of patient care access, and the COVID-19 pandemic. Elected in 2022, Dr. Khan leverages his health care background to address a wide range of legislative issues, passing significant bills. He advocates for NPs to engage politically, emphasizing their unique perspective and problem-solving skills. Dr. Khan's story underscores the transformative potential of NPs in shaping public policy and advancing systemic change.
